Laser Safety
This is a page printer which operates by means of a laser. There is no possibility of
danger from the laser, provided the printer is operated according to the instructions
in this manual.
Since radiation emitted by the laser is completely confined within protective hous-
ing, the laser beam cannot escape from the machine during any phase of user
operation.
Internal Laser Radiation
Maximum Radiation Power:
0.6 mW at laser aperture of the print head unit
Wavelength:
770–810 nm
This product employs Class IIIb Laser Diode that emits an invisible laser beam.
Laser Diode and Scanning Polygon Mirror are incorporated in the print head unit.
The print head unit is not a field service item.
Therefore, the print head unit should not be opened under any circumstance.
Laser Safety
This printer is certified as a Class I Laser product under the U.S. Department of
Health and Human Services (DHHS) Radiation Performance Standard according
to the Radiation Control for Health and Safety Act of 1968. This means that the
printer does not produce hazardous laser radiation.
